Teil 1 of the distance time graph worksheet contains 20+ skills-based distance choose graph practice questions, in 3 groups to support differentiation; Section 2 contains 4 applied distance zeitlich graph questions with a mix of worded … WebStep 1: Recall that the gradient of a velocity-time graph gives the acceleration. Calculating the gradient of a slope on a velocity-time graph gives the acceleration for that time period. Step 2: Draw a large gradient triangle at the appropriate section of the graph. A gradient triangle is drawn for the time period between 5 and 10 seconds below:

WebVelocity-time graphs Determining acceleration. For a moving object, the velocity can be represented by a velocity-time graph. A horizontal line on a velocity-time graph, … WebYou often need to find the area under a velocity-time graph since this is the distance travelled. Area under a curved graph = ½ × d × (first + last + 2 (sum of rest)) d is the …
